aboutsummaryrefslogtreecommitdiffstats
path: root/packages/nvidia-drivers/files/nvaudio-remap_page_range.patch
diff options
context:
space:
mode:
Diffstat (limited to 'packages/nvidia-drivers/files/nvaudio-remap_page_range.patch')
-rw-r--r--packages/nvidia-drivers/files/nvaudio-remap_page_range.patch27
1 files changed, 27 insertions, 0 deletions
diff --git a/packages/nvidia-drivers/files/nvaudio-remap_page_range.patch b/packages/nvidia-drivers/files/nvaudio-remap_page_range.patch
new file mode 100644
index 0000000000..e653d43a76
--- /dev/null
+++ b/packages/nvidia-drivers/files/nvaudio-remap_page_range.patch
@@ -0,0 +1,27 @@
+--- NFORCE-Linux-x86-1.0-0310-pkg1/nvsound/main/Makefile.kbuild.sav 2006-05-16 09:44:26.000000000 -0600
++++ NFORCE-Linux-x86-1.0-0310-pkg1/nvsound/main/Makefile.kbuild 2006-05-16 09:48:57.000000000 -0600
+@@ -48,16 +48,16 @@
+ EXTRA_LDFLAGS := -d
+
+ # Figure out how many args remap_page_ranges() wants or new remap call
+-ifeq ($(shell sh $(src)/conftest.sh "$(CC)" "$(KERNEL_SOURCES)" "$(KERNEL_OUTPUT)" remap_pfn_range), 1)
++#ifeq ($(shell sh $(src)/conftest.sh "$(CC)" "$(KERNEL_SOURCES)" "$(KERNEL_OUTPUT)" remap_pfn_range), 1)
+ EXTRA_CFLAGS += -DNV_REMAP_PFN_RANGE_PRESENT
+-else
+- REMAP_PAGE_RANGE := $(shell sh $(src)/conftest.sh "$(CC)" "$(KERNEL_SOURCES)" "$(KERNEL_OUTPUT)" remap_page_range)
+-
+- ifeq ($(REMAP_PAGE_RANGE),5)
+- EXTRA_CFLAGS += -DREMAP_NEW
+- endif
++#else
++# REMAP_PAGE_RANGE := $(shell sh $(src)/conftest.sh "$(CC)" "$(KERNEL_SOURCES)" "$(KERNEL_OUTPUT)" remap_page_range)
+
+-endif
++# ifeq ($(REMAP_PAGE_RANGE),5)
++# EXTRA_CFLAGS += -DREMAP_NEW
++# endif
++#
++#endif
+
+ PATCHLEVEL ?= $(shell sh ./conftest.sh "$(CC)" "$(KERNEL_SOURCES)" "$(KERNEL_OUTPUT)" kernel_patch_level)
+ ifeq ($(PATCHLEVEL), 4)